The purpose of Ritual of Refreshment in World of Warcraft
Written by .

Ritual of Refreshment in World of Warcraft - Image 1Blizzard’s recent World of Warcraft Public experiment Realm 2.3.0 patch notes stated that the mage’s upcoming skill called the Ritual of Refreshment requires two units of arcane powder. Since Conjure Water and Conjure Food allow that class to create either food or water for the raid with no spell components, some members of the class have begun to question the necessity of adding that new ability.

Blizzard Poster/Community Manager Bornakk answered the players saying that the new spell will be saving raid parties a lot of moment since the mage no longer has to cast spells individual water and food spells multiple times. In addition to that, he plus pointed out that players will only need one slot for food and water unlike before making it a useful upgrade to the current skill set they have now.

Bornakk made some pretty good points and quite a number of the mages on the forum community agreed with him on his assessment of the new skill. From all indications, Ritual of Refreshment will be a Raid staple spell when patch 2.3.0 becomes available.
